Hey everyone,
Long time lurker ... (turns out, threre's not much reason to post when you know how to search) ... but I've got a super random question that I couldn't quite find.

Now, I know how stupid this is about to sound, so flame away, but does anyone know of a way to adjust the gas / break / clutch pedals? I'm kindof a shorter guy (5'5") and I really don't want to be eating the steering wheel when I need to get the pedals to the floor. Especially with the positioning of the gear shifter, it just makes an awkward fit in the car.


Anyone have any ideas?

The pedals in the Z are not adjustable. I would google "pedal extenders" and see what you come up with.
